HVAC Repair FAQs in Central Park, WA

Warm air from your AC in Central Park, WA is usually caused by low refrigerant levels, a dirty evaporator coil, or a failing compressor. A quick inspection and diagnostic by Local HVAC Repair Masters will identify the issue and get your home cooling again.
High-efficiency units consume significantly less energy to heat and cool your home, which lowers your monthly utility bills. They also often provide more consistent temperatures and better humidity control in Central Park, WA.
Yes, part of our comprehensive replacement service includes safely recovering old refrigerant, disconnecting, and hauling away your old heavy units for environmentally responsible disposal so you don't have to deal with them.
A well-maintained air conditioning unit typically lasts 10 to 15 years, while a gas furnace can last 15 to 20 years. Regular annual tune-ups are key to maximizing the lifespan of your equipment.
